Conventional bags lack real-time tracking, tamper detection, and emergency response mechanisms, making them highly vulnerable in crowded environments such as public transportation, educational institutions and travel scenarios. The Internet of Things has emerged as a transformative technology that enables physical devices to communicate and exchange data over networks, thereby enhancing system intelligence and responsiveness. “IoT enables real-time monitoring and tracking of assets through interconnected smart devices” [1]. The proposed IoT-based smart security bag integrates GPS tracking, GSM communication, camera-based monitoring, and tamper detection to provide a multi-l</span><span>ayered</span><span><span> </span>security system. “Multi-l</span><span>ayered</span><span> security architectures improve system robustness by combining detection, alerting, and prevention mechanisms” [2]. The system also incorporates cloud storage for remote accessibility and data persistence.
